First thank you to Grace Ayaa for suggesting that Children of Hope partner with Life in Africa, and for visiting wonderful Esther Atoo, Director of Children of Hope in Lira, northern Uganda.
Since my March, 2007 visit to the original 43 orphans victimized by the Lord's Resistance Army, I have found it hard to help from such a great distance in Canada. Life in Africa's Web Empowerment has closed the gap.
Paying school fees for 163 orphans and vulnerable children is the goal. Sustainability is the problem.
Esther and I have been planning some income generating activities to put Children of Hope on a sustainable footing. She has already organized paper bead necklace production with the caregivers committee, as these gorgeous necklaces sell very well in Toronto.
The next income generating project, sewing school uniforms, depends on the purchase of 5 sewing machines for $700 Cnd. A small grant from Life in Africa would help us keep these children in school for a better future for them and their communities.
